User Guide
Everything PDFWise can do, and how to use it — scan, organize, sign, convert, and protect your documents, all processed on your own device.
Quick start
Three steps from a paper document (or an existing file) to a finished PDF.
- Add a document. Tap the Scan button on Home to capture a paper document with your camera, or the + button to import a PDF, Word, Excel, text, or image file — non-PDF files convert to PDF automatically. You can also share a file to PDFWise from any other app, or choose "Open with PDFWise" on a file already on your device.
- Open the Toolkit and pick a tool — merge, split, compress, watermark, protect, e-sign, convert, or edit. Every tool works on documents already in your PDFWise library.
- Land back on Home with the result highlighted. Finishing a tool returns you to your library with the new or edited file highlighted, ready to open, share, or save straight to your Downloads folder.
The Toolkit
Every tool runs entirely on your device — nothing is uploaded to process it.
Merge
Combine two or more PDFs into one file, in the order you choose.
Split
Break a PDF apart by page ranges (e.g. "1-3, 5") or into one file per page.
Compress
Shrink file size with an adjustable quality slider that re-encodes embedded images.
Image to PDF
Turn one or more photos into a single PDF, one page per image.
Watermark
Stamp a diagonal text watermark across every page.
Protect
Lock a PDF with a real AES-256 password so only people you share it with can open it.
Remove Password
Take the password off a PDF you can already unlock, once you no longer need it protected.
e-Sign
Draw, upload, type, or reuse a saved signature — drag to reposition and resize it before applying, with a quick Undo right after signing.
Word to PDF
Convert a .docx file's text and basic formatting (bold, italic, headings) to PDF, on-device.
Excel to PDF
Convert an .xlsx workbook's cell values into a paginated PDF grid, one section per sheet.
Edit PDF
Fill in a PDF's real form fields when it has them, or freehand draw and add typed text anywhere on the page when it doesn't.
A note on conversions: Word-to-PDF and Excel-to-PDF are built to work fully offline, without a third-party conversion service. They convert text, basic formatting, and cell values accurately, but complex layouts, tables, embedded images, charts, and cell formatting from the original file aren't reproduced.
Scan & Search
Scan
Capture paper documents with your camera. Edges are detected and cropped automatically, and you can capture multiple pages into a single PDF before saving.
Search
Every scan runs through on-device text recognition (OCR) in the background, so you can search across both document titles and the text inside your scans.
Viewer & sharing
Tap any document in your library to open it.
- Share — send the PDF through any app on your device via the system share sheet.
- Save to Downloads — copy the file into your device's public Downloads folder.
- Unlock — if a document is password-protected, the viewer prompts for the password before rendering the pages.
On Home, each document's icons let you Share, Rename, or Delete it — or press and hold any document to select several at once for a bulk delete.
Backup & Restore
Connect your own Google Drive to keep a copy of your library off-device.
- Files are backed up to a private "PDFWise Backups" folder that only PDFWise can see in your Drive — the app never sees the rest of your Drive.
- Turn on Auto backup daily to back up new or changed PDFs automatically.
- Wi-Fi only keeps auto-backup from using mobile data.
- Restore pulls your backed-up documents back down onto a new or reset device.
Personalize
Found under Settings.
- Appearance — choose Light (default), Dark, or Accent, a bolder brand-forward color scheme.
- Language — PDFWise's interface is available in 20 languages, with English as the default; change it any time from Settings.
- Smart reminders — an optional daily nudge if you haven't opened PDFWise yet that day.
- Biometric app lock — require your fingerprint or face to open PDFWise, on devices that support it.
Streaks, badges & unlocks
The Insights tab tracks your real usage — nothing here is cosmetic.
- Daily streak — tracked from your device clock; use any tool once a day to keep it alive.
- Badges — a 15-badge catalog for first-time use, usage milestones, streaks, and storage saved.
- Levels — an XP system with named levels based on how much you've used the app.
- Weekly report — a Monday-to-Sunday chart of your activity, with a week-over-week comparison.
- Wrapped & badge cards — once you've used the app long enough, a yearly Wrapped recap and shareable badge cards become available from Insights too.
Every tool on the Toolkit grid is available from the start — no unlocking required.
Privacy, built in
- PDFWise is offline-first: scanning, merging, splitting, compressing, watermarking, password-protecting, e-signing, converting, and editing all happen on your device — your files aren't uploaded anywhere to be processed.
- No account or sign-in is required to use the app.
- Google Drive backup is entirely opt-in, and scoped so PDFWise can only see the one backup folder it creates — never the rest of your Drive.
